CATLETTSBURG — North Laurel’s Brooklyn Mullins had save-after-save during Thursday’s Elite 8 showdown with high-scoring Boyd County showing why she was voted the best keeper in the 13th Region.
In Mullins had more than 10 saves in North Laurel’s second stunner in a row, defeating the Lady Lions, 1-0, and will now advance to its first Final Four appearance since 2020.
The win improves the Lady Jaguars to 13-3 on the season while Boyd County finishes with a 19-3-1 mark…
